Modes: Modes:
Two modes are available. Two modes are available.
@ -51,12 +52,16 @@ show_usage()
To run under this mode, just start the script without any option (you can also use --live explicitly) To run under this mode, just start the script without any option (you can also use --live explicitly)
Second mode is the "offline" mode, where you can inspect a non-running kernel. Second mode is the "offline" mode, where you can inspect a non-running kernel.
You'll need to specify the location of the kernel file, config and System.map files: This mode is automatically enabled when you specify the location of the kernel file, config and System.map files:
--kernel kernel_file specify a (possibly compressed) Linux or BSD kernel file --kernel kernel_file specify a (possibly compressed) Linux or BSD kernel file
--config kernel_config specify a kernel config file (Linux only) --config kernel_config specify a kernel config file (Linux only)
--map kernel_map_file specify a kernel System.map file (Linux only) --map kernel_map_file specify a kernel System.map file (Linux only)
If you want to use live mode while specifying the location of the kernel, config or map file yourself,
you can add --live to the above options, to tell the script to run in live mode instead of the offline mode,
which is enabled by default when at least one file is specified on the command line.
